Abstract
681,282. Drum brakes. INDIA RUBBER, GUTTA PERCHA & TELEGRAPH WORKS CO., Ltd., TARRIS, F. J., and WEBB, D. Jan. 23, 1951 [Jan. 31, 1950], No. 2539/50. Class 103 (i). A brake comprising a frame 1, a shoe or shoes 8, a pair of expansible tubes 4, 5 disposed side by side between the shoe or shoes and the frame and arranged to be expanded by fluid pressure to apply the shoe or shoes to a relatively movable friction surface (not shown), and also comprising spring means acting in opposition to the tubes to disengage the shoe or shoes on release of fluid pressure, is characterized in that at least one of the shoes has a pillar 12 secured thereto and extending between the two tubes through the frame, away from the friction surface; the spring means 13 acting between the pillar and the frame. As shown, the tubes 4, 5 of an internal expanding drum brake are connected to a common fluid supply 7. A plurality of shoes 8 carry bars 10 of friction material disposed in lateral slots in the arcuate shoe surface. The spring 13 engages a recess 14 in the frame 1 and a collet 15 which has a slot 17 allowing it to be slip over the end 16 of the pillar 12 and rotated through 90 degrees, whereupon the pillar head 16 engages slots 18 and is locked therein. The post 12 is a sliding fit in the frame 1 and serves as an anchor for the shoe. Side flanges 9 on the shoes 8 co-operate with the frame 1 to guide the shoes radially.
